Add milk, canola oil, eggs and vanilla extract – one ingredient at a time – whisking until smooth. Prepare … WebMar 8, 2024 · Place the batter in a jar or container with a tight-fitting lid. Store for up to 2 days and cook in the waffle iron as directed. For cooked leftover waffles, place them in an air-tight container or Ziploc bag. Store in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. To reheat, warm, or toast in your toaster oven or regular oven.
